Features
Energy Efficiency - Inverter compressor, EC fan and electronic expansion valve are standard configurations for DXA series
- Air is directly drawn from the hot aisle, allowing the unit to take advantage of higher heat transfer efficiency due to higher Delta T.
- Cold aisle/Hot ailse containment avoids mixing of cold and hot air
